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4141 81916582 500923150 8156 8144516067
41890665 994803935 15
41890665 994803935 15
802 55 60444 658213536 935130
All about undefined
Interested in learning more?
41890665 994803935 15
802 55 60444 658213536 935130
See more
6162149459 54 8225431811
4728239 872136 2411
See more
18 194195 153761
907228 55920208 9446174947 5018
See more